Engrampa's current packaging includes a dependency and recommends that
are unneeded. The attached debdiff removes these requirements and makes
installing engrampa on a non-MATE desktop quite a bit lighter.

caja-common: Engrampa seems to run without issue without this package.
If this is related to the Caja integration, it should be noted that this
is a hard requirement for Caja.

mate-icon-theme: This package does not provide an icon for engrampa.
Engrampa provides its own icon in engrampa-common.

engrampa-common: /usr/share/icons/hicolor/16x16/apps/engrampa.png
engrampa-common: /usr/share/icons/hicolor/22x22/apps/engrampa.png
engrampa-common: /usr/share/icons/hicolor/24x24/apps/engrampa.png
engrampa-common: /usr/share/icons/hicolor/32x32/apps/engrampa.png
engrampa-common: /usr/share/icons/hicolor/scalable/apps/engrampa.svg
